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
41 872434 30805063102
2926284 1079
2926284 1079
903496125 574349732 767
All about undefined
Interested in learning more?
2926284 1079
903496125 574349732 767
See more
9773001 238
960532 80 84
See more
8632020188 59216577
2716 013 999 6575202220
See more